Output 57ab83d3400a8c1bf76ac8b0afeafdea7102711b1e7aaa929aa50e91c1c3e87f:0

value
43492330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6aee98a4eb625f707118fe50f4724b8e0b5182a4 OP_EQUAL
address
3BSRNqVwA4Wca6yMyCTGiaPtMaYAaoaYNV
transaction
57ab83d3400a8c1bf76ac8b0afeafdea7102711b1e7aaa929aa50e91c1c3e87f
confirmations
262895
spent
true